When stored properly in an airtight container, baked beans can last in the refrigerator for up to 4-5 days. It's important to keep them in the coldest part of the fridge to prolong their shelf life. However, if you notice any changes in smell, texture, or appearance, it's best to discard them to avoid any risk of foodborne illness.

Your cooked beans last about 3 to 5 days in the fridge. To store them, let the beans cool down after cooking, then pop them in the refrigerator within an hour. Getting them stored quickly and chilled in the fridge will help prevent the growth of bacteria.

How long does an unopened can of baked beans in sauce last at room temperature? Properly stored, an unopened can of baked beans in sauce will generally stay at best quality for about 3 to 5 years, although it will usually remain safe to use after that.
